Samsung officially launched the Galaxy A56 5G and A36 5G at Mobile World Congress 2025. These smartphones offer cutting-edge AI, upgraded cameras, and improved performance.
Samsung designed both models with a sleek, modern aesthetic. The 7.4mm slim profile ensures a comfortable grip. The A56 5G comes in Awesome Pink, Olive, light gray, and Graphite.
Meanwhile, the A36 5G is available in Awesome Lime, Awesome Black, Awesome Lavender, and Awesome White.
Both phones feature a 6.7-inch FHD+ Super AMOLED display. The screen delivers vibrant colors and deep contrast, and a peak brightness of 1,200 nits ensures visibility even in direct sunlight.
The smooth refresh rate makes scrolling and gaming seamless.
Performance is a significant highlight. The Galaxy A56 5G runs on the Exynos 1580 processor. It has 8GB or 12GB of RAM with 128GB or 256GB storage options.
The A36 5G uses the Snapdragon 6 Gen 3 processor. It comes with similar RAM and storage options. Both support a microSD card for an additional 1TB of storage.
Battery life is a strong suit for both devices. Each phone houses a 5,000 mAh battery. The 45W fast-charging support ensures quick power-ups.
Samsung’s adaptive battery technology enhances longevity by optimizing energy use.
Camera capabilities have been significantly upgraded. The A56 5G features a 50MP primary sensor, a 12MP ultra-wide lens, and a 5MP macro camera.

The A36 5G also has a 50MP primary sensor but with an 8MP ultra-wide lens. Both models include a 12MP front camera for high-quality selfies.
AI-driven enhancements take photography to the next level. Features like AI subject detection, noise reduction, and night photography improve image quality.
Software innovations also stand out. Running Android 15 with One UI 7, these devices introduce Samsung’s “Awesome Intelligence” AI capabilities. The new Circle to Search feature allows users to find information by circling objects on the screen.
AI-powered editing tools like Object Eraser make photo adjustments simple.
Samsung promises long-term software support. Both phones will receive six years of OS and security updates, ensuring a secure and updated experience for years to come.
Durability is another strong point. The front and rear are made with Corning Gorilla Glass Victus+ for added protection. Both devices carry an IP67 rating, making them resistant to dust and water.
Samsung plans to launch these models on March 27, 2025. The Galaxy A56 5G starts at $699, and the A36 5G is priced at $549. These models offer a flagship-like experience at a budget-friendly cost.
